Output 22a104d07aa79ac563410f1452dd7a6cb78535afff54eca064fb7a7115c06c9b:0

value
44301020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90878eb5be40a46952aebca1ed4772e53591bb55 OP_EQUAL
address
3EsDcs7X3KDNN38L1D8d3WJ2zhXMN4UQgV
transaction
22a104d07aa79ac563410f1452dd7a6cb78535afff54eca064fb7a7115c06c9b
confirmations
337330
spent
true